Concentration of Nitrosodimethylamine in Commercial Pelleted Experimental Animal Diets
To know the conditions of contamination by the chemicals in the experimental animal diets, the contents of nitrosodimethylamine (NDMA) were analyzed in the diets for mice and rats. The raw materials of the diets were also analyzed. In addition, NDMA levels were determined in the diets which were stored long or heated in the autoclaves.

β‐Catenin/c‐Myc Axis Modulates Autophagy Response to Different Ammonia Concentrations
Ammonia, detoxified by the liver into urea and glutamine, impacts autophagy differently at varying levels. Low ammonia activates autophagy via c‐Myc and β‐catenin, while high levels suppress it. Using Huh7 cells and Spf‐ash mice, c‐Myc's role in cytoprotective autophagy is revealed, offering insights into hyperammonemia and potential therapeutic ...
